City responds to
‘dirty water’ claim in Hong Kong magazine
Following claims in a Hong Kong magazine that Pattaya uses
substandard water supplies, specifically in the hotel in which the
publication’s reporters were staying, Pattaya Mail spoke with Thanet
Supornsaharungsi, Pattaya Business and Tourism Association president.
Thanet told the Pattaya Mail, “The PBTA is aware of
the article, which was given to us by the hotel in question. In conjunction with
the Tourism Authority of Thailand and Pattaya City, we have inspected the hotel
and found that in reality a series of incidents led to the misunderstanding.

Master diver addresses Pattaya City Expats Club

Carl Dorf from CJ’s Dive Shop and Guesthouse located in
Soi Regent Marina (Soi Zero) off Beach Road was the guest speaker recently
at the Pattaya City Expats Sunday meeting at Henry J. Bean’s Restaurant.
